Giant Bo Pilgrim Head

Saves: 1
Check-ins: 0
While other large oddities in Texas are quite amusing, the Giant Bo Pilgrim Head has a touch of the sinister to it. Mounted on a white platform with eight legs, it looks like a giant's dinner of a decapitated pilgrim. Interestingly enough, the head rests in front of a giant freezer/food distribution facility.